About Vanguard All-Equity ETF Portfolio
Vanguard All-Equity ETF Portfolio (the ETF) seeks to provide long-term capital growth. Fund investing primarily in equity securities. The ETF may do so either directly or indirectly through investment in one or more exchange-traded funds managed by Vanguard Investments Canada Inc (the Manager) or an affiliate or certain other investment funds (Underlying Funds). Under normal market conditions, the sub-advisor will strive to maintain a long-term strategic asset allocation of 100% equity securities.
